Anyone stayed at BW Presidential in NYC

I am staying in NYC in mid-July and was considering the BW in times square. My preferred hotel is the Hilton Garden on 8th a block away but noticed the rates were similar and this stay would qualify me for another free night certificate with their promo this summer.

Is the hotel nice on the inside? Looks dated on the outside. Was also wondering if people had any luck with upgrades as Diamonds there.

Originally Posted by CanucksHKG
Anyone been to BW Times Sq lately?
Last summer. What is your question?

If you are asking for BW Diamond benefits: Nothing at all! No late check-out, no upgrade, no welcome amenity, no other benefit.

Location is perfect if you want to stay near Times Square. But that's pretty much all I liked. The room was modern and very nice but one of the smallest rooms I ever had!

I would not visit this hotel again if there are alternatives for a similar price!

If you are referring to the BW The President, I have stayed there several times. The rooms are tiny, with a hip/modern motif in the decor. I do not recommend staying there during the hot season (~Jul-Sep), as the air conditioning units in the rooms are pitifully inadequate, even for such tiny rooms.

This property is a very good redemption value for points, given its location.
